The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Peterborough with a requirement for Power Platform sk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Power Platform over the 6 months to 27 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
27 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 13 42 32
Rank change year-on-year +29 -10 -9
Permanent jobs citing Power Platform 21 2 26
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Peterborough 8.90% 1.01% 9.12%
As % of the Cloud Services category 29.17% 3.13% 26.80%
Number of salaries quoted 17 0 21
10th Percentile £25,450 - -
25th Percentile £25,750 - £31,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£30,000 - £42,500
Median % change year-on-year - - -29.17%
75th Percentile £51,250 - £48,094
90th Percentile £59,000 - £53,750
Cambridgeshire median annual salary £47,500 £45,000 £44,466
% change year-on-year +5.56% +1.20% -19.15%
